1 Exhibit (d)(4) STOCKHOLDERS AGREEMENT STOCKHOLDERS AGREEMENT, dated as of February 14, 2000 (this "Agreement"), among AT&T Corp., a New York corporation ("Parent"), LMN Corporation, a Delaware corporation and a wholly owned subsidiary of Parent ("Sub"), and Gerald R. McNichols, an individual ("Stockholder') and a stockholder of GRC International,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"Company"). WHEREAS, Parent, Sub and the Company are, concurrently with the execution hereof, entering into an Agreement and Plan of Merger, dated as of February 14, 2000 (the "Merger Agreement"), pursuant to which, upon the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in the Merger Agreement, Sub will make an offer (the "Offer") to acquire all of the issued and outstanding shares of common stock, par value $0.10 per share, of the Company (the "Company Common Stock"), at a purchase price of $15.00 per share, net to the seller in cash, the consummation of which will be followed by the merger of Sub with and into the Company, with the Company being the surviving corporation (the "Merger"); WHEREAS, Stockholder is the record and/or beneficial owner of 2,001,700 shares of Company Common Stock (collectively, the "Existing Shares") (all such Existing Shares, together with all other shares of capital stock or other voting securities of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ries with respect to which Stockholder has beneficial ownership (for purposes of this Agreement, "beneficial ownership" shall have the meaning set forth in Rule 13d-3 under the Exchange Act) as of the date of this Agreement, and any shares of capital stock or other voting securities of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ries, beneficial ownership of which is directly or indirectly acquired after the date hereof, including, without limitation, shares received pursuant to any stock splits, stock dividends or distributions, shares acquired by purchase or upon the exercise, conversion or exchange of any option, warrant or convertible security or otherwise, and shares or any voting securities of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ries received pursuant to any change in the capital stock of the Company or such Subsidiary by reason of any recapitalization, merger, reorganization, consolidation, combination, exchange of shares or the like, are referred to herein as the "Shares"); WHEREAS, each of the parties hereto desires to enter into this Agreement to provide for, among other things, (1) the obligation of Stockholder to tender, or cause the record holder of the Shares to tender, the Shares beneficially owned by Stockholder (other than Shares subject to unexercised options) (the "Tender Shares") in the Offer, (2) the obligation of Stockholder to vote, or cause the record holder of the Shares to vote, the Shares beneficially owned by Stockholder (other than Shares subject to unexercised options) (the "Voting Shares") in the manner specified herein and (3) certain restrictions on the sale or the transfer of the record and beneficial ownership of Shares by Stockholder (this Agreement and all other agreements, instruments and other documents executed and delivered by Stockholder in connection with this Agreement are collectively referred to as the "Support Documents"); and WHEREAS, Stockholder acknowledges that Parent and Sub are entering into the Merger Agreement in reliance on the representations, warranties, covenants and other agreements of Stockholder set forth in this Agreement and would not enter into the Merger Agreement if Stockholder did not enter into this Agreement. 2 N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ing and the respective representations, warranties, covenants and agreements set forth herein and in the Merger Agreement, and intending to be legally bound hereby, Parent, Sub and Stockholder agree as follows: 1. Defined Terms. Terms used herein without definition shall have the meanings assigned to such terms in the Merger Agreement. 2. Agreement to Tender. Stockholder hereby agrees to validly tender, or cause the record owner to validly tender, all of the Tender Shares pursuant to and in accordance with the terms of the Offer within 18 business days of the commencement thereof, and not to withdraw or permit to be withdrawn any Shares therefrom. 3. Agreement to Vote. Stockholder hereby agrees that, from and after the date hereof and until the Termination Date (as defined in Section 19), at any meeting of the stockholders of the Company, however called, or in connection with any written consent of the stockholders of the Company, Stockholder shall appear at each such meeting, in person or by proxy, or otherwise cause the Voting Shares to be counted as present thereat for purposes of establishing a quorum, and Stockholder shall vote (or cause to be voted) or act by written consent with respect to all of the Voting Shares that are beneficially owned by him or as to which he has, directly or indirectly, the right to vote or direct the voting, (a) in favor of adoption and approval of the Merger Agreement and the Merger and the approval of the terms thereof and each of the other actions contemplated by the Merger Agreement and this Agreement, and any other action reasonably requested by Parent in furtherance thereof; (b) against any action or agreement that would result in a breach of any covenant, representation or warranty or any other obligation or agreement of the Company contained in the Merger Agreement or of Stockholder contained in this Agreement; and (c) against any Acquisition Proposal made by any person other than Parent or any of its affiliates. Stockholder hereby agrees that he will not enter into any voting or other agreement or understanding with any person or entity or grant a proxy or power of attorney with respect to the Shares prior to the Termination Date (other than a proxy or power of attorney to an officer of the Company that may be exercised solely in accordance with this Section 3 and except as provided in Section 4 below) or vote or give instructions in any manner inconsistent with clause (a), (b) or (c) of the preceding sentence. Stockholder hereby agrees, during the period commencing on the date hereof and ending on the Termination Date, not to, and, if applicable, not to permit any of his affiliates to, vote or execute any written consent in lieu of a stockholders meeting or vote, if such consent or vote by the stockholders of the Company would be inconsistent with or frustrate the purposes of the other covenants of Stockholder pursuant to this paragraph. Termination. This Agreement and the proxy set forth in Section 4 shall terminate upon the earliest of the following dates (such date is referred to herein as the "Termination Date"): (i) the date on which the Merger Agreement is terminated in accordance with Article VIII thereof; (ii) the date on which Parent terminates this Agreement upon written notice to Stockholder (Parent may so terminate this Agreement and the proxy set forth herein at any time); (iii) the Effective Time; and (iv) June 30, 2000. 20.
